Since the late 1960s, Medigas has been a leader in serving the Canadian healthcare market with the provision of home oxygen therapy, respiratory services, medical gases and related medical equipment. Home Medical Equipment Delivery Driver (Full Time) - Barrie, ON
Primary Purpose
This position is responsible for providing home delivery and pickup of home medical and oxygen equipment products, including respiratory equipment to clients.
Key Accountabilities
- Deliveries, setups, and pickups of home medical/oxygen equipment within an assigned route in a prompt, courteous, and professional manner
- Responsible for coordinating vehicle maintenance
- Safely loading and unloading of home medical and oxygen equipment
- Work within a high safety standard while identifying and communicating any safety hazards at delivery sites
- Responsible for completing various regulatory paperwork, including TDG, Vehicle Inspection Reports, Hours of Service etc.
- Complete routine assessments of equipment and identify potential repairs at customer sites
- Provide verbal product education and supporting documentation to clients in accordance with company procedures
- Troubleshoot equipment malfunctions
- Maintain good housekeeping practices
- Complete daily inventory tasks
- Ability to work various shifts, including days, evenings, weekends, and holidays
- Must be available for afterhours/on-call emergency service on a rotational basis
